Transaction 38e718d2d2e71a5c114f976819a6e9c59be79224ebe34a643dc5068f924253a0

2 Input
1 Outputs
  • 38e718d2d2e71a5c114f976819a6e9c59be79224ebe34a643dc5068f924253a0:0
  • value  1080056
    address  1oWbCwNDDkKXXLCSrhAEDYfUp1MQbK2xi